Brookline Transportation
Statistics about Brookline transportation to place of work. Includes type of vehicle, rates of carpooling, use of public/private transportation, travel time to work, and time leaving home for work.
Workers 16 and over
32,173
100.0%
Used a car, truck, van
16,881
52.5%
Drove alone
14,571
45.3%
Carpooled
2,310
7.2%
2 people
2,038
6.3%
3 people
191
0.6%
4 people
55
0.2%
5 or 6 people
20
0.1%
7 or more people
6
0.0%
Average workers per car/truck/van
1.08
Used public transportation
9,242
28.7%
Bus or trolley bus
1,510
4.7%
Streetcar or trolley car
2,647
8.2%
Subway or elevated
4,883
15.2%
Railroad
85
0.3%
Ferry
0
0.0%
Taxi
117
0.4%
Used a motorcycle
12
0.0%
Used a bicycle
580
1.8%
Walked
3,073
9.6%
Other means of transportation
178
0.6%
Worked at home
2,207
6.9%
Workers who did not work at home
29,966
100.0%
Less than 10 minutes
2,113
7.1%
10 to 14 min.
2,409
8.0%
15 to 19 min.
3,882
13.0%
20 to 24 min.
5,291
17.7%
25 to 29 min.
2,228
7.4%
30 to 34 min.
5,520
18.4%
35 to 44 min.
3,790
12.6%
45 to 59 min.
3,222
10.8%
60 to 89 min.
1,175
3.9%
90 or more min.
336
1.1%
Average travel time in minutes
28.0
